What does a PR executive do?

A PR Executive, or Public Relations Executive, is responsible for managing an organization's image and reputation. They develop and implement communication strategies, write press releases, organize events, and build relationships with media outlets. Their main goal is to ensure positive publicity and handle any negative press effectively. PR Executives also monitor public opinion and advise their company or clients on communication matters.

How does a PR executive typically collaborate with other departments within an organization?

A PR Executive often works closely with departments such as marketing, sales, and product development to ensure consistent messaging and effective communication strategies. Collaboration may involve coordinating press releases, aligning on campaign timelines, and gathering technical details or customer feedback for public statements. This cross-functional teamwork helps create unified brand messaging and maximizes the impact of PR efforts. Regular meetings and clear communication channels are essential for successful collaboration.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a PR executive, and why are they important?

To thrive as a PR Executive, you need strong written and verbal communication skills, a bachelor's degree in communications, public relations, or a related field, and a solid understanding of media relations. Familiarity with PR management tools, social media platforms, and media monitoring systems is typically required. Exceptional interpersonal skills, creativity, and crisis management abilities help you stand out in this role. These skills are crucial for building a positive public image, effectively managing brand reputation, and ensuring successful communication strategies.
